New Health Plan Option

The Municipal Labor Committee negotiated a new premium free Healthcare plan option for members in DC37 employed by New York City, the NYC Employees PPO or NYCE PPO plan. If you are a HIP member you will not automatically be switched to the new NYCE PPO plan. HIP members will stay with their current plan, unless you choose to change your healthcare plan during the open enrollment period. Your current doctors may not know the name of the plan just yet, but will come January 1, 2026.

Below are a few highlights of the plan, which will take effect on January 1, 2026.

  • Expands the number of providers from the network Emblem Health.
  • The increase goes from 64,000 providers to 78,000 providers in New York City, Long Island, Dutchess, Putnam, Orange, Ulster, Rockland and Westchester Counties
  • Members can keep current doctors
  • Reduction of pre-authorizations by 50%
